Neil Larsen teaches and directs the Program in Critical Theory at the University of California—Davis. He is the author of numerous articles on literary and cultural theory and of the following books: Modernism and Hegemony (1989), Reading North by South (1995) and Determinations: Essays on Theory, Narrative and Nation in the Americas (2001).
